Transaction 281e705774a9fbc7e65f602bf6678054fb232212631ff94c4b8ff2a53b48109a

1 Input
2 Outputs
  • 281e705774a9fbc7e65f602bf6678054fb232212631ff94c4b8ff2a53b48109a:0
  • value  651871546
    address  bc1qytjf9qach7y6gu0r3v2ggcq6lhnzzghr24cnr8
  • 281e705774a9fbc7e65f602bf6678054fb232212631ff94c4b8ff2a53b48109a:1
  • value  19614000
    address  33xSbugKSFbiL6tHBTtTXjSU7CHQfrYQhL